Why Fujitsu suits Wellington homes
- Reliable value. Fujitsu gives you dependable heating without paying for the very top tier, which is why it's one of our most common installs.
- Broad range. There's a Fujitsu unit for most situations, from a small bedroom high-wall to a whole-home ducted system.
- Coastal-grade options. Salt air corrodes outdoor units fast. Fujitsu's corrosion-resistant models suit exposed coastal homes around Plimmerton, Titahi Bay, Raumati and Eastbourne.
- Good efficiency. Solid energy ratings keep your running costs sensible through a long Wellington heating season.
The Fujitsu range
Fujitsu covers a wide spread of tiers, so there's usually a tidy fit for the room and the budget. We'll match the tier to your home, not push you towards the dearest option. You'll see the same span across the main heat pump types we fit, from high-wall to ducted.
| Tier | Best for |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Value high-wall series | Bedrooms, smaller living areas | Efficient, quiet, keenly priced |
| Mid-range high-wall series | Main living areas | Wi-Fi control, better filtration, higher output |
| Coastal-grade models | Salt-air and exposed coastal homes | Corrosion-resistant build for longer outdoor-unit life |
| Floor console | Replacing a fire, rooms with low wall space | Warmth at floor level |
| Ducted | Whole-home heating | Hidden in the ceiling, one system, several rooms |

Warranty
Fujitsu heat pumps usually carry a 5-year manufacturer's warranty in New Zealand when fitted by a qualified installer. Because we service what we fit, if a warranty issue ever comes up it's handled by the people who know your system. There's more on that on our heat pump servicing and repairs page.
